How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Inkster?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Inkster Studio Apartments | $1,197 | $725 | $1,889 |
| Inkster 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,241 | $849 | $2,000 |
| Inkster 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,583 | $975 | $3,300 |
| Inkster 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,296 | $1,349 | $3,600 |
| Inkster 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,750 | $3,600 | $3,900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Inkster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Inkster?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Inkster is at Farmington Manor Apartments listed at $725.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Inkster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Inkster is $1,484.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Inkster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Inkster is a 2,750 square feet unit starting from $1,550 at Claymoor Luxury Apartments.
What is the average size for Inkster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Inkster is currently at 731 sq ft.
